Featured image of post 使用 Rust 编写操作系统:带你逐步实现 | 开源日报 No.371

使用 Rust 编写操作系统:带你逐步实现 | 开源日报 No.371

blog_os 是使用 Rust 编写操作系统的项目。

phil-opp/blog_os

Github Repo Stars License: Language:

cover

blog_os 是使用 Rust 编写操作系统的项目。

  • 提供逐步教程,每篇博文对应一个功能模块
  • 包含多个主题:裸机环境、中断处理、内存管理、多任务等
  • 代码以不同分支形式存在,方便查看每个博文后的中间状态
  • 第二版已发布,第一版虽已过时但仍可能有用

afadil/wealthfolio

Github Repo Stars License: Language:

demo-picture-of-wealthfolio

wealthfolio 是一个美观、私密且安全的桌面投资跟踪应用程序。

  • 本地数据存储,无需订阅或云服务
  • 导出数据功能
  • 支持债券投资选项
  • 蒙特卡洛组合预测功能
  • 可通过账户导入 CSV 文件配置文件 该项目使用了 React、React Query 等技术,并采用 Tauri 框架构建,提供了易于使用的用户界面和图表库。

levihsu/OOTDiffusion

Github Repo Stars License: Language:

demo-picture-of-OOTDiffusion

OOTDiffusion 是 Outfitting Fusion based Latent Diffusion for Controllable Virtual Try-on 的官方实现。

  • 支持 VITON-HD 和 Dress Code 数据集上训练的模型
  • 提供 Hugging Face 链接以获取模型检查点
  • 支持 ONNX 格式的 humanparsing
  • 仅在 Linux (Ubuntu 22.04) 上测试通过

Anttwo/SuGaR

Github Repo Stars License: Language:

cover

SuGaR 是用于高效 3D 网格重建和高质量网格渲染的表面对齐高斯飞溅的官方 PyTorch 实现。

  • 从 3D Gaussian Splatting 重建中提取精确且极快速的网格
  • 引入正则化项以促使 3D Gaussians 与场景表面对齐
  • 利用这种对齐性进行采样并使用 Poisson 重建从 Gaussians 中提取网格
  • 可选细化策略将 Gaussians 绑定到网格表面,通过 Gaussian splatting 渲染同时优化这些 Gaussians 和网格,便于编辑、雕刻、动画制作或重新照明等操作。

pheralb/svgl

Github Repo Stars License: Language:

demo-picture-of-svgl

svgl 是一个使用 Sveltekit 和 Tailwind CSS 构建的美丽 SVG 图标库。

  • 发现、请求和提交 logo
  • 使用 Sveltekit 进行网页开发
  • 支持 Typescript、Markdown 和 Syntax Highlighter
  • 使用 Tailwind CSS 快速构建自定义设计
  • 提供一系列头部组件和友好的图标库
  • 包含各种工具和插件,如代码格式化器、Toast 组件等功能
  • 提供 API 以及相关扩展,如 CLI 工具、Figma 插件等支持社区贡献者创建的项目
Licensed under CC BY-NC-SA 4.0